Choosing the right venue is crucial for a two-day celebration. The Hyatt Regency Hill Country is an excellent option, offering ample indoor and outdoor spaces that can accommodate large gatherings while providing luxurious amenities. The venue's picturesque surroundings and extensive services can enhance the overall experience, making it ideal for both the wedding ceremony and reception.
Food is a significant aspect of any Muslim wedding, with a budget of approximately $102,960 to $205,920. It is essential to work with caterers who specialize in halal cuisine to ensure the dietary requirements are met. Consider offering a diverse menu that includes traditional dishes, contemporary favorites, and options for guests with dietary restrictions.
With 20% of the budget allocated to décor, you can create a stunning atmosphere that reflects the couple’s style and cultural heritage. This includes floral arrangements, lighting, and themed decorations. Hiring a professional decorator who understands Muslim wedding traditions can help in crafting an elegant and culturally respectful environment.
San Antonio's hot summers can pose challenges for logistics and guest comfort. It is vital to consider air-conditioned venues and shaded outdoor areas to keep guests cool. Scheduling events during cooler parts of the day, such as late afternoon or evening, can also enhance comfort levels. Providing refreshments and shaded seating can further improve the guest experience.
